Interpreting RTP, volatility, variance and hit frequency in crypto games
Understanding RTP, volatility, variance, and hit frequency helps players set realistic expectations on a crypto casino without kyc. RTP, or return to player, describes the theoretical long-run percentage of wagered money returned to players over time. In crypto games, RTP figures are often stated for each game or bet type, but real results will deviate in the short term due to randomness. Volatility and variance describe how widely outcomes deviate from the average; high volatility games may deliver large wins but less frequently, while low volatility games tend to produce smaller wins more often. Hit frequency is another practical metric indicating how often a winning outcome occurs within a given session. In practice, you can experience days with multiple small wins and occasional big losses, or vice versa. It is important to distinguish theoretical RTP from actual results and to plan staking and bankroll accordingly on a crypto casino without kyc.

Bonus mechanics and wagering rules on a crypto casino without kyc
Bonuses on a crypto casino without kyc may include welcome offers, free spins, or reload bonuses that credit in cryptocurrency. However, wagering requirements, game weighting, and maximum-bet rules can significantly affect your ability to withdraw winnings. Wagering requirements specify how many times a bonus amount must be played before a withdrawal is allowed; game weighting means different games contribute differently to those requirements, with some games contributing less or more toward progress. Watch expiry dates for bonuses and any withdrawal restrictions tied to promotions. Some operators impose maximum withdrawal caps for bonus winnings or require additional verification steps for large payouts, even on no-KYC platforms. Always read the terms carefully, and consider how a bonus interacts with your intended bet sizes and game choices on a crypto casino without kyc.
